Date: March 16
Address: Grace Church of Harmony,
Main Street, Harmony
Contact: getfitfamilies.com, or
724.321.4265
The Shamrock Shuffle is an annual event
to benefit the Zelienople Rotary Club. The
half marathon is one of the toughest in
the tri-state area, with a big climb about 6
miles into the race. The 5K and 1-mile races
are family-friendly events on rolling hills.
Athletes have the option to run all three
races. There is no better way to celebrate
St. Patrick’s Day than this fun race! Enjoy
the quaint town of Harmony following the
race by visiting the shops and restaurants.
Finisher medals for all races. Beer glasses
for awards, and each runner gets a loaf of
gourmet cinnamon swirl bread. Sign up
today and have some fun!
